College basketball rankings: 3 B1G teams land in top 25 on post-Christmas AP Poll

College basketball rankings are getting updated with a new AP Top 25 coming out after Christmas.

For most teams in the B1G, the schedule around the Christmas break features nonconference games and a brief break in the league schedule before the new year. Come January, teams will get ready for the full B1G slate and race to March Madness.

With the final AP Poll of 2022, Purdue hangs onto its No. 1 ranking nationally with a 12-0 overall record. The rest of the top 5 remains unchanged this week with UConn, Houston, Kansas and Arizona rounding out the top 5.

Wisconsin and Indiana joined Purdue as top-25 B1G teams while Maryland, Illinois, Ohio State and Michigan State landed in the “Others receiving votes” section.

Here’s how the full AP Poll looks entering the week of Dec. 26:

#1 Purdue
#2 UConn
#3 Houston
#4 Kansas
#5 Arizona
#6 Texas
#7 Tennessee
#8 Alabama
#9 Arkansas
#10 Gonzaga
#11 UCLA
#12 Baylor
#13 Virginia
#14 Miami (FL)
#15 Wisconsin
#16 Indiana
#17 Duke
#18 TCU
#19 Kentucky
#20 Auburn
#21 Mississippi State
#22 New Mexico
#23 Xavier
#24 West Virginia
#25 North Carolina

Others receiving votes: Charleston 102, Maryland 87, Memphis 74, Illinois 65, Ohio State 59, Virginia Tech 57, Missouri 57, San Diego State 39, Iowa State 19, Marquette 12, Texas Tech 10, Michigan State 7, Providence 6, Kansas State 5, USC 4, San Francisco 1
